NVIDIA GeForce RTX 2050 GPU For Laptops Is 23% Faster Than GTX 1650 & Packs DLSS/RT Goodies

MechRevo, a Chinese manufacturer of laptop computers, recently revealed benchmark results of the upcoming NVIDIA GeForce RTX 2050 laptop GPU, revealing that the new design from NVIDIA is more efficient than comparable GPUs.
MechRevo benchmark tests show an exciting discovery of NVIDIA's underpowered laptop GPU in conjunction with the 3DMark Fire Strike benchmark tests. The current results find that the RTX 2050 is approximately 23% more efficient than the previous GeForce GTX 1650 and about 134% faster than the NVIDIA MX450. The RTX 2050 nearly delivers a similar performance compared to the company's GeForce MX570. The MX570 is NVIDIA's low-power discrete GPU designed for lightweight and thin laptops.

The NVIDIA GeForce RTX 2050 is furnished with an Ampere GPU offering 2048 CUDA cores onboard. The design is identical to the NVIDIA GeForce MX570 and RTX 3050 GPUs. The significant difference is the memory size and width of the bus, which is restricted to 2GB and 64-bit, respectively. The lower amount of memory and bus size is the cause of the card's limitations.
MechRevo also furnished video encoding efficiency outcomes that showcase the FullHD and UltraHD screen resolutions. Interestingly enough, Intel Xe graphics, which offer 96 Execution Units, show an unfavorable performance comparison in all encoding tests provided by the Chinese laptop manufacturer.
We should expect to see the NVIDIA RTX 2050 GPU begin to appear in laptops during the Spring of this year.
